Overview

The Jianhu JH-SSX Series Cyclic Salt Spray Test Chamber is an engineered environmental test system designed for accelerated corrosion evaluation under dynamically alternating conditions. Unlike conventional steady-state salt fog chambers governed solely by ASTM B117, the JH-SSX integrates programmable temperature, humidity, and atmospheric phase sequencing—enabling precise replication of real-world corrosive exposure cycles such as coastal maritime environments, industrial urban atmospheres, or automotive under-hood thermal-humidity transients. Its core operational principle relies on controlled aerosol generation via compressed-air-assisted atomization, followed by regulated chamber conditioning across four distinct phases: salt spray, dry-off, high-humidity soak, and saturated condensation. This multi-stage cyclic protocol accelerates electrochemical degradation mechanisms—including chloride-induced pitting, crevice corrosion, and galvanic coupling—while maintaining metrological traceability to international standards. The chamber’s double-wall insulated stainless steel construction, PID-controlled heating/cooling modules, and calibrated humidity generation system ensure long-term stability in setpoint maintenance (±0.5°C temperature uniformity; ±2% RH accuracy), essential for GLP-compliant test repeatability.

FAQ

What standards does the JH-SSX meet for cyclic corrosion testing?

It complies with ISO 9227 (cyclic A/B/C), ASTM G85 Annexes A1–A5, GB/T 2423.18, and VW PV1210. Full validation reports are provided with each unit.
Can the chamber operate continuously in neutral salt spray mode only?

Yes—the controller supports standalone ASTM B117 operation with adjustable spray duration, temperature setpoint (35°C ± 2°C), and deposition rate verification.
Is third-party calibration certification available?

NIST-traceable calibration certificates for temperature, humidity, and deposition rate are available as optional factory services (ISO/IEC 17025 accredited provider).
What maintenance intervals are recommended for long-term reliability?

Daily: Drain sump tank and inspect nozzle; Quarterly: Replace humidifier wick and verify sensor drift; Annually: Full system recalibration and pressure regulator servicing.
